# Load test config — Cartwheel checkout flow
# Owner: release eng. Target: staging cluster only.
# Simulates 500 concurrent buyers through cart, payment, and confirmation.
# Do NOT point LOADGEN_TARGET at production; billing stubs are staging-only.
# Ramp profile lives in ramp.yaml; keep step duration at 120s or the
# payment mock drops connections. Results post to the Vexhall dashboard
# after each run. Rotate credentials after every release cycle.
# The payment-mock signing secret goes on the next line.

sealed setting: VAULT_KEY20=69e2a0b23f1a79fbf692

### CI Note: EXIF Scrubbing Failures

If the Pictureweave pipeline fails at the scrub stage, check whether the test fixtures contain GPS tags — the scrubber treats any residual location data as a hard error by design. Regenerate fixtures with the sanitize script before re-running, and never mark the check as skipped. Verify the scrub stage passed by matching its token, printed just below.

session token of tadug-bagep = htk9_7d92de289

MEMO — Kettling Depot Receiving

Uniform sets for the new Kettling depot arrive Wednesday via Ashgrove courier: 40 boxes, sorted by size, manifest attached to box one. Check the count at the dock before signing; shortages go straight to stores, not the courier. The hand-over instruction the courier will follow is set out below.

drop instructions, tafof-baguf: the holmir gilox courier leaves the sormir ulaok holdor ledger at gate 5596 under passcode 257343

## Deployment — Bindery Catalogue Import

The Bindery importer ingests MARC-style catalogue exports from the Hollowbrook library consortium and loads them into the search index. Deploy it only after the nightly index snapshot completes, since a mid-import failure requires a restore. New team members should run a dry-run against staging first and compare record counts with the source export. Once counts match, promote with the standard pipeline using the production configuration shown below.

config for kafof-bawef:
holath:
  log_level: debug
  metrics_host: metrics.holath.qorvelsys.internal
  pin: 2191
  pool_size: 32